John Watson School

Littleworth Road, Wheatley, OX33 1NN

Community special school for ages 2–19 in Wheatley. Mixed intake.

John Watson School is a community special school in Oxford for boys and girls aged 2 to 19. It has nursery classes, a sixth form and special classes. Its SEN provision spans specific learning difficulty, speech, language and communication needs, autism, physical disability, moderate, severe and profound learning difficulty, and other difficulties or disabilities.

Ofsted rated the school Good at its last full inspection (2016). Its wide age range and broad SEN provision make this a specialist setting for pupils with varied communication, physical and learning needs.
